Show o A HILL TOP TIMES November 7, 1973 35 Page Why can't the items for sale or trade again be put in the (H)AMA Bulletin and a charge of 25 cents per ad made? This small charge would probably pay for the Bulletin and the ad too. People would be happy to pay the fee. The OOAM A Bulletin is an official bulletin governed by Air Force and Air Force Logistics Command policy, and as such may not contain classified advertising. "For Sale" and "Will Trade" items, as well as other information type items, were discontinued to comply with Air Force Manual 1 - AFLC Sup 1, paragraph , Arrangements have been made with the Hill Top Times, to publish this type of information. Hill All union representatives aren't afforded reserved parking, only union officers and chief stewards, and the chief stewards only when a motor vehicle is necessary in the performance of their duty. Reference Memorandum of Agreement between Hq Ogden Air Materiel Area, Hill Air Force Base and Local 1592, American Federation of Government Employees, Article XXIII, paragraph 4, page 20. This sytcm, through the publicize use of computer equipment, identifies and ranks employees who arc eligible for promotion consideration. At an installation the size of Hill, the mechanized skills locator system is a much more effective and rapid method of locating promotion candidates than the use .of promotion announcements. The use of this system is required by higher headquarters except in rare and unusual instances. Vacancies at other Air Force activities are publicized when there are insufficient employee cligiblcs at that activity to consider for promotion.
